Projektet förväntas leverera betydande framsteg på vägen mot att öka verkningsgraden i en förbräningsmotor till 60 %.Abstract: The overall goal of this project (D60-2) is to study possibilities to significantly increase the fuel efficiency of internal combustion engines. As the title implies the goal is to reach 60% efficiency. In order to reach this, all losses in the fuel conversion process must be taken into account and minimized. The main focus is on building knowledge related to in-cylinder heat transfer. D60 is an existing cluster project divided into three individual subprojects (on the request of the Energy agency). - D60m: Detailed engine heat transfer modeling. - D60e: Engine experiments and system modeling. - D60l: Advanced optical- and laser-diagnostics. The overall goal for the activity in D60l-2 is to build knowledge around the subject of remote temperature probing and to provide D60m-2 with reliable data from the thermal boundary layer for validation of heat transfer models. For this second phase the cluster will greatly benefit from the momentum of ongoing activities and is expected to produce a substantial amount of scientific results while striving towards the 60% efficient engine. An important addition to this second phase is to include bio-fuels in the research activities.
